About this map

Sheyenne River meanders through a deeply incised valley in this late-1960s survey of southeastern North Dakota. The landscape is defined by the contrast between the flat upland agricultural fields and the wooded, winding river corridor. Fort Ransom serves as the primary settlement, positioned near the historic Site of old Ft Ransom. The area is notably rich in indigenous and early frontier landmarks, including several clusters of Indian Mounds, the Writing Rock, and prominent terrain features such as Bears Den Hillock and The Pyramid.
